Which is better for pre-med research: UT Austin or Ohio State?

I’m a high school senior choosing between UT Austin and Ohio State and plan to pursue pre-med. Research opportunities are one of my main priorities, so I want to understand which school generally offers stronger access to meaningful undergraduate research and mentorship.

UT’s College of Natural Sciences has biology, neuroscience, chemistry, public health, and biomedical labs connected to a major research university.

The Freshman Research Initiative is the clearest differentiator. Students work in small research groups under faculty and graduate-student guidance, often continuing in a lab after the initial sequence. That structure can make it easier to build sustained relationships, technical skills, and eventual recommendation letters for medical-school applications, rather than spending a first year sending cold emails for openings.

Ohio State offers outstanding research, particularly through the Wexner Medical Center and its large academic health system. It can be especially strong for clinical, translational, cancer, neuroscience, and public-health research, with abundant faculty and hospital-based projects.

UT Austin also benefits from proximity to Dell Medical School and growing health-related research in Austin, while retaining a more undergraduate-visible research entry point. At either institution, the best outcome will come from joining a lab early and staying long enough to take on meaningful responsibility.
